Description

Gray foliage and a low spreading form make this perennial an attractive small-scale groundcover or border plant. Foliage is topped in summer with creamy white flowers about an inch across. Easy to grow in most gardens. This is a local native found on coastal bluffs with Iris, Monkeyflower, Sage, Seaside Daisy, and Yarrow. The Smith's Blue Butterfly relies on this plant and E. parvifolium as its only two food sources for their entire life cycle.
